Spring batch expression Cron: pour exécuter chaque 3 heures
Je veux que mon spring batch pour exécuter toutes les 3 heures
J'ai utilisé l'expression * * */3 * * ?
cela commence le travail à l'heure qui est divisible par 3 par exemple, dire que le serveur a été démarré à 2 H, le travail commence à s'exécuter seulement à 3 PM - c'est très bien, mais le travail continue de départ à chaque seconde! Est-ce parce que j'ai utilisé * en 1ère position?
J'ai essayé 0 0 */3 * * ?
mais il est erroring arrière. Quelle est la meilleure façon d'atteindre cet objectif?
Vous devez vous connecter pour publier un commentaire.
Le format est
donc la bonne expression cron doit être
Si cela ne fonctionne pas, quel est le message d'erreur exact que vous obtenez?
La bonne syntaxe pour faire le script à exécuter toutes les 3 heures est comme ci-dessous.